3) Q ---  Is there any way to add a link rather than specifying all
the links and saving? I have a lot of links being created
simultaniously and it's impossible for me to load the links, add one,
and save it without missing some links elsewhere. (from hassox via
#riak)

    A --- At the moment there is no clean and simple way.  You can do
it via sibling-merge but that would require writing some custom code.

5) Q ---  Is there a way to see a family tree style illustration of a
riak object's vclock history? (from hassox via #riak)

    A ---  Vclocks, while exceptional at handling version control,
don't actually expose a hierarchical history of object updates. So,
no, this is not possible.
